LVtools
Reproducible, accurate and rapid ventricular assessment
   
 
LVtools is a CMRtools plug-in for left ventricular CMR image assessment. It allows the calculation of key cardiac indices including ejection fraction, cardiac mass and volume. LVtools is designed to provide rapid, accurate and reproducible analysis by following an intuitive step-by-step workflow that guides the user through the different analysis tasks required. User interaction is permitted at all stages of the analysis workflow to ensure the accuracy of the results and to deal with cases with complex cardiac morphology or poor image quality.
 
In LVtools, the motion of the valves is taken into account for calculating the volume and mass of the ventricle. The position and orientation of the valves are identified at end-diastole and end-systole, and then temporally interpolated to exclude regions that belong to the left atrium. The resulting calculation of the cardiac indices does not make any assumptions concerning the geometry of the ventricle.
